Output 72409a13d3f6cd7b538e2907661178d3dc8dbea064c4f968177c9d894ac16b2e:51

value
32954989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b224043a47a99c7e9fd04d9a0a1726f60c24dad2 OP_EQUAL
address
MQ95f3hKmZmC6ti1MUK9U9vPNcxg7euLre
transaction
72409a13d3f6cd7b538e2907661178d3dc8dbea064c4f968177c9d894ac16b2e
spent
true